Police: 1 Dead, 4 Injured in Hampton Shooting

HAMPTON, Va. (AP) — Police say a shooting at a home in Hampton left one man dead and four people injured.

Hampton police said in a statement that officers were called to the scene shortly after 12:30 a.m. Tuesday. When they arrived, they found three men in a side yard suffering from gunshot wounds.

Twenty-one-year-old Devyn Andre Reed of Hampton was pronounced dead at the scene. A 19-year-old Hampton man and a 21-year-old Wakefield man were taken to a hospital with injuries not considered life-threatening.

While officers were investigating, a man and woman from Hampton, both 19, arrived at a hospital each with a single gunshot wound. Police said they were also shot at the home, where a preliminary investigation shows a large gathering or party was taking place.

The motive and circumstances surrounding the incident are under investigation.
